Visual Basic 语言程序设计教程

Visual Basic 语言程序设计教程 pdf epub mobi txt 电子书 下载 2026

出版者:
作者:
出品人:
页数:319
译者:
出版时间:2008-11
价格:32.00元
装帧:
isbn号码:9787508460345
丛书系列:
图书标签:
  • Visual Basic
  • VB
  • 编程入门
  • 程序设计
  • 教程
  • 计算机科学
  • 开发
  • Windows应用
  • 教学
  • 代码示例
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《Visual Basic语言程序设计教程》第二版以“能力培养为主线”、以“激发学生兴趣”为着眼点,详细介绍了Visual Basic6.0程序设计语言的基础知识和程序设计的方法与技术。全书共分15章,包括Visual Basic概述、Visual Basic可视化编程基础、窗体、常用标准控件、Visual Basic语法基础、顺序结构、选择结构、循环结构、数组、过程、文件、菜单与对话框、数据库、图形处理、程序的测试与软件调试以及3个附录。所有例题的Visual Basic程序均经计算机调试通过。

与第一版相比较,《Visual Basic语言程序设计教程》第二版重点、难点突出,尽可能与计算机二级考试紧密结合:在体系结构、章节内容编写的安排方面更加合理;各章相对独立、内容详实完整且前后呼应;数据来源可信、可靠;针对性强、可读性好;关键章节均有“一题多解编程思路及其应用”例题,进一步突出了《Visual Basic语言程序设计教程》“一题多解”的编写特色;习题新颖,以调动读者学习计算机技术基础课程的兴趣和积极性,提高读者的学习效率。

《Visual Basic语言程序设计教程》特别适合高等职业教育、高等专科、本科等院校计算机专业及非计算机专业的学生使用,也可作为面向计算机入门人员的培训教材及有关专业教师、技术人员参考。

《Visual Basic语言程序设计教程》还配有辅助教学指导书《Visual Basic语言程序设计教程实验指导及习题解答》(第二版)。与《Visual Basic语言程序设计教程》配套的电子教案可以从中国水利水电出版社网站免费下载。

《现代Web开发实践指南》 简介: 在数字化浪潮席卷全球的今天,Web应用程序已成为企业运营、信息传播和用户交互的核心载体。本书《现代Web开发实践指南》旨在为有志于投身Web开发领域,或是希望系统提升Web开发技能的开发者提供一份全面而深入的实践指导。本书不涉及任何关于Visual Basic语言的知识点,而是聚焦于当下最流行、最具活力的Web技术栈,从前端到后端,从基础理论到高级应用,层层剥茧,力求帮助读者构建出高效、稳定、用户体验卓越的现代Web应用。 本书首先会带您走进现代Web开发的基础殿堂。我们将从HTML5和CSS3的最新规范出发,深入讲解语义化标签、响应式布局、CSS预处理器(如Sass/Less)的应用,以及如何利用Flexbox和Grid等布局模型轻松实现复杂页面结构。您将学习到如何构建美观、易用的用户界面,掌握CSS动画和过渡的技巧,为您的Web应用注入生命力。 紧接着,我们将进入JavaScript的世界。本书将从ES6+的新特性入手,如箭头函数、Promise、Async/Await、模块化等,帮助您编写出更简洁、更高效的代码。在此基础上,我们将深入介绍当前主流的JavaScript前端框架,如React、Vue.js或Angular(根据具体篇幅选择一到两种重点讲解,例如,如果重点讲解React,则会详细介绍其组件化开发思想、JSX语法、状态管理(如Context API、Redux/Zustand)、Hooks机制以及路由管理等)。通过实际案例,您将学会如何利用这些框架构建单页面应用(SPA),实现复杂的用户交互和数据驱动的UI更新。 在后端开发部分,我们将聚焦于Node.js及其生态系统,或者Python (Django/Flask) / Java (Spring Boot) / Go (Gin/Echo) 等一种或多种主流后端语言和框架(同样,根据篇幅和侧重点选择,例如,如果重点讲解Node.js,则会深入探讨Express.js或Koa.js等框架,学习如何构建RESTful API,处理HTTP请求,实现用户认证和授权,数据库集成等)。您将学习如何设计健壮的服务器端逻辑,如何与数据库进行高效交互(如SQL的MySQL/PostgreSQL,或NoSQL的MongoDB/Redis),如何实现数据持久化和缓存策略。 数据存储是Web应用不可或缺的一环。本书将详细讲解关系型数据库(如MySQL、PostgreSQL)的设计原则、SQL语言的高级查询技巧、索引优化以及事务管理。同时,我们也会介绍NoSQL数据库(如MongoDB、Redis)的应用场景和优势,以及如何在Web应用中有效地集成和使用它们。 安全性是Web应用开发的重中之重。本书将系统介绍Web安全的基本概念,包括跨站脚本攻击(XSS)、SQL注入、CSRF攻击的原理和防御方法。您将学习如何实现安全的身份验证和授权机制,如何对敏感数据进行加密存储和传输,以及如何遵循OWASP Top 10等安全最佳实践。 在部署和运维方面,本书将引导您了解Docker容器化技术,学习如何打包和部署Web应用,实现环境的一致性和快速伸缩。同时,我们也会触及CI/CD(持续集成/持续部署)的概念,介绍如何自动化构建、测试和部署流程,提高开发效率和软件质量。对于前端应用,还会涉及Webpack/Vite等打包工具的使用,优化资源的加载和分发。 本书的每一章节都将结合丰富的实际项目案例,从一个简单的“待办事项列表”到更复杂的“电商平台”、“社交网络”等,让读者在实践中学习和巩固知识。代码示例清晰易懂,并且注重代码的可读性和可维护性。此外,我们还将分享一些性能优化的技巧,如前端代码压缩、懒加载、CDN使用,以及后端API的响应速度优化等,帮助读者构建出更具竞争力的Web应用。 《现代Web开发实践指南》不仅是一本技术手册,更是一份通往Web开发前沿的导航图。无论您是初学者,希望打下坚实的基础,还是有一定经验的开发者,渴望掌握最新技术,都能从中获益。通过本书的学习,您将能够独立设计、开发、部署并维护功能强大的现代Web应用程序,为您的职业生涯开启新的篇章。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的习题设计部分,我认为是其最大的亮点之一,也是我个人学习过程中投入时间最多的部分。它并没有采用那种简单的“填空题”或者“修改一处错误”的练习模式。相反,很多章节末尾的综合性项目,要求读者必须整合前面学到的好几个知识点才能完成。比如,要求设计一个简单的库存管理系统,这不仅仅测试了你对输入输出的处理能力,还考验了你对数据结构的选择以及界面的布局逻辑。让我印象深刻的是,作者在给出题目后,并没有立即提供标准答案,而是附带了一系列“思考方向”和“可能遇到的陷阱提示”。这种引导性的设计,极大地鼓励了独立思考,迫使我们去尝试不同的解决方案,而不是机械地模仿书上的范例。我记得有一次被一个特定的错误卡住了很久,最后通过回顾书里关于错误处理机制的章节,才恍然大悟。这种“授人以渔”的教学理念,远比直接给出解决方案要有效得多,它让学习过程充满了探索的乐趣和解决问题的成就感。

评分

从装帧和排版上看,这本书的实用性是毋庸置疑的。它采用了那种在图书馆或工作台上非常耐翻的平装设计,纸张的质地也比较厚实,不容易洇墨。虽然封面设计略显保守,但内页的排版却非常清晰高效。代码块的字体选择恰到好处,既保证了辨识度,又没有占用过多的页面空间。更值得称赞的是,书中对关键术语和核心代码段落使用了不同的强调方式,比如斜体、粗体或者背景色块,这使得在快速查阅时,眼睛能迅速定位到重点信息。我经常在需要快速回顾某个特定函数用法时,不需要从头翻到尾,而是能凭着记忆中的颜色或格式,直接找到相应的位置。这种对阅读体验的细致考量,体现了作者和编辑团队对目标读者——那些需要在编程实践中频繁查阅参考资料的学习者——的深刻理解。虽然这本书内容详实,页数不少,但清晰的结构和人性化的排版,让它更像一本工具书,而非一本只能从头读到尾的教科书。

评分

对于我这样一位已经接触过其他几种编程语言的开发者来说,这本书在讲解中体现出的语言特性对比分析,是我最欣赏的部分。它并没有将这门语言孤立地看待,而是在适当的时机,会穿插一些与其他主流语言(比如C++或早期的BASIC方言)在实现方式上的异同点对比。例如,在讲解属性(Property)的封装机制时,它会明确指出这与纯粹的getter/setter方法之间的优势差异,帮助我们理解设计者选择这种抽象层次的原因。这种横向的视角,极大地拓宽了我对编程范式的理解,让我不仅学会了如何使用这门语言的语法,更理解了它背后的设计哲学。这种高屋建瓴的讲解方式,避免了我们陷入对特定语法细节的纠结,而是培养了一种更宏观的架构思维。因此,即便是对于有经验的程序员,这本书也能提供新的见解,因为它不仅仅是一本“How-to”手册,更是一部关于特定编程环境思想演进的精炼总结。

评分

说实话,这本书的行文风格比起现在市面上那些追求“酷炫”和“快速上手”的编程书籍,显得要沉稳得多,甚至有些许学院派的味道。它不太热衷于在开篇就展示如何用几行代码做出一个花哨的动态效果,而是花了不少篇幅去解释“为什么”要这么做,背后的逻辑和底层原理是什么。这种对理论基础的重视,在涉及到事件驱动模型的那几个章节体现得尤为明显。作者似乎不愿意跳过任何一个可能引起混淆的概念,即便是对于那些看似简单的控件的属性和方法,也会进行详尽的剖析,告诉你它们在内存中是如何被处理的。这种严谨的态度,对于我这种希望深入理解语言机制而非仅仅停留在“会用”层面的学习者来说,简直是福音。当然,这也带来了一个小小的副作用,就是初期的阅读体验可能略显枯燥,尤其是在处理完一堆关于数据结构和类型转换的章节后,很容易让人产生“这什么时候才是个头”的错觉。但坚持下来后,会发现这种“慢工出细活”的教学法,为后续学习更复杂的框架和库打下了无比牢固的基础,少了以后返工修正底层理解错误的麻烦。

评分

这本书的封面设计得相当朴实,那种带着点老派气息的深蓝色和白色字体组合,让人一眼就能感受到它想传递的“正统”和“权威”。我拿到手的时候,首先翻阅了一下目录,感觉内容覆盖面挺广的,从最基础的变量、数据类型讲起,一直延伸到面向对象编程的概念,甚至还触及了数据库的一些初步操作。对于一个完全的编程新手来说,这种循序渐进的结构无疑是非常友好的。尤其是前几章对程序流程控制的讲解,作者似乎很注重通过大量的图示和流程图来辅助说明,这极大地降低了初学者理解循环和条件判断的门槛。我记得当时在学习如何构建一个简单的用户界面时,书里提供的代码示例清晰明了,每一步骤都有详细的注释,不像有些教材只是简单地堆砌代码,让人摸不着头脑。总的来说,作为一本入门教材,它成功地搭建了一个坚实的知识框架,让人感觉学习编程不是一个遥不可及的抽象过程,而是一门可以通过系统学习掌握的实用技术。我对它在基础知识点的深度和广度都表示满意,特别是对新手构建信心方面起到了很好的引导作用。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有